Title:
  WiFi stopped working on hirsute with bcmwl

Status in bcmwl package in Ubuntu:
  New

Bug description:
  I own a MacBook Air 6,2 on which I've installed several versions of
  Ubuntu. I recently updated to the hirsute (21.04) pre-release, but
  WiFi has stopped working. Some web searching suggested re-installing
  the bcmwl-kernel-source package, which produced the following output:
